The Sand Road Waste Site accepts the following materials:

  • Household Waste
  • Recycling
  • Brush
  • Scrap Metal (stoves, refrigerators, washer and dryers, dishwashers, freezer, air conditioners, stainless steel, steel, and metal patio furniture as some examples)
  • Electronic Waste
  • Organic Wet Waste
  • Household Hazardous Waste (*Note: Only on Saturdays during the summer)

Residents will require a Waste Site & Transfer Station Permit/Card or as it is more commonly referrred to as the "Green Card".  If you do not have the Waste Site & Transfer Station Permt/Card then you must pay $2.00 per bag to dispose of your Household Waste.  Method of payment is cash only.  If you are not a frequent visitor to the site please provide proof of residency (driver's license, tax bill, and/or a residency card may be obtained at the Municipal Office) to the Waste Site Attendant).

The Waste Site & Transfer Station Permit/Card are available at the Municipal Office or from the Waste Site Attendant.The fee for the Permit/Card is $20 for a half card (10 squares/$2.00 per square) and they have no expiry.  The Municipal Office does sell a $40 full card (20 squares/$2.00 per square) option.

The Sand Road Waste Site is also home to the Household Hazardous Waste Depot.  The depot is only open on Saturdays and is typically open the Saturday of the long weekend in May and closes the last Saturday in September.  For more information pertaining to the hours of operation and items accepted at the Hazardous Waste Depot, please visit the Household Hazardous Waste Depot section of our website.
